Dr. Phodie Musa Kamara is a highly accomplished researcher and engineering professional specializing in material selection and design within the context of sustainable and climate-resilient infrastructure. With a strong academic foundation, including a doctorate in highway and transportation engineering, he has developed extensive expertise in integrating material performance with environmental and structural demands. His work focuses on optimizing material choices for durability, efficiency, and resilience, particularly in transport systems exposed to climate variability and extreme conditions. Over a distinguished career spanning more than two decades, he has played a pivotal role in the planning, design, and management of large-scale infrastructure projects, contributing to the development of sustainable road networks across Sierra Leone and beyond. He is widely recognized for incorporating advanced material strategies into climate adaptation frameworks, addressing challenges such as flooding, erosion, and long-term asset performance. In addition to his technical contributions, Dr. Kamara has been actively involved in policy development, research dissemination, and interdisciplinary collaboration, bridging the gap between engineering practice and scientific innovation. His research outputs, including publications on climate vulnerability and infrastructure resilience, have influenced both academic and practical approaches to sustainable development. Through his leadership roles and commitment to excellence, he continues to advance material design strategies that support robust, adaptive, and future-ready infrastructure systems.
